Ionescu’s 22 points propel Liberty to 76-62 victory over Aces, securing spot in WNBA Finals

Sabrina Ionescu had a stellar performance, scoring 22 points to lead the New York Liberty to a 76-62 victory over the Las Vegas Aces. This win secured the Liberty’s spot in the WNBA Finals, where they will have home-court advantage against either the Connecticut Sun or Minnesota Lynx. It marks the Liberty’s sixth appearance in the finals as they continue their quest for their first league title.

After suffering a defeat at the hands of the Aces in the playoffs last year, the Liberty turned that disappointment into motivation for this season. With an impressive record of 6-1 against Las Vegas including the playoffs, the Liberty have established themselves as the top team in the league.

In addition to Ionescu’s standout performance, Breanna Stewart contributed 19 points and 14 rebounds, Jonquel Jones added 14 points despite dealing with foul trouble, and Leonie Fiebich finished with 11 points. On the Aces’ side, A’ja Wilson recorded 19 points, 10 rebounds, and five blocked shots, while Kelsey Plum and Tiffany Hayes chipped in with 17 and 11 points respectively.

Ionescu quickly bounced back from a subpar performance in Game 3 by scoring 12 points in the first quarter, setting the tone for the Liberty. The game remained close until the fourth quarter when the Liberty pulled away, outscoring the Aces 23-11 in the final period to secure the victory.

The Aces, aiming to make history by winning back-to-back titles, saw their 12-game home playoff winning streak come to an end. The absence of center Kiah Stokes due to a concussion further challenged the Aces’ efforts in this crucial game.
